How do I wash my baby boy’s private parts?
You can use a cotton ball and warm water to clean your baby’s genitalia. If you’d like, you could mix a small amount of water with a mild cleanser that includes a moisturizer. Ensure that all cleaner is removed from your baby’s genital area. When you change your baby’s diaper or give them a bath, you can clean their genitalia.

Should you pull a baby’s foreskin back to clean?
For cleaning, there is no need to pull it back. It’s okay if your child pulls back his or her foreskin in the shower or bathtub, but it’s not necessary. It is best for your child to do this in the bath or shower to clean once they have reached puberty and can easily pull back the foreskin.
When should you clean a boy’s foreskin?
Cleaning beneath the foreskin needs to be done frequently once it can be retracted. To gently pull back the foreskin, teach your child to. Use mild soap and water to clean the area beneath the foreskin.

Should I change a poopy diaper if baby is sleeping?
You should change them as soon as possible, though perhaps not immediately, if you do hear or smell a poop. According to Mochoruk, a breastfed baby’s poop isn’t particularly irritating to the skin, so if they are sound asleep and you anticipate that they will wake up soon anyway, you can safely postpone it for a little while.

What are the signs your child is ready to potty train?
If your child shows two or more of these signs, it’s a good indication that they’re ready to start potty training:
- tugging at a soiled or wet diaper.
- hiding while you urinate or poop.
- expressing an interest in other people’s bathroom behavior or imitating it.
- having a dry diaper for a longer period of time than usual.
- waking up dry after a nap.

How often do newborns need a bath?
How frequently does my infant require a bath? You don’t have to bathe your newborn child every day. Until your baby is more mobile, three times per week may be sufficient. Overbathing your child can cause the skin to become dry.

When should a child start talking?
Typically, babies start babbling around six months and say their first words between ten and fifteen months (most start speaking at about 12 months). After about 18 months, they start to pick up an increasing number of words and start putting them together into simple sentences.

When can you tell a baby’s eye color?
Wait until your child turns one before choosing their eye color because a baby’s permanent eye color is not fixed until they are at least nine months old. Even then, you might occasionally encounter small surprises. Up until around age 6, minor color changes can still take place.

What cures diaper rash fast?
The best way to prevent diaper rash on your baby is to keep their skin as dry and clean as you can. Your healthcare provider may advise the following if the rash doesn’t clear up after using home remedies: Using a mild hydrocortisone (steroid) cream twice daily for three to five days. If your baby has a fungal infection, use an antifungal cream.

What is Dreamfeed?
Dream feeding is the practice of feeding a sleeping infant with the intention of lulling the infant to sleep for an extended period of time. The phrase has also been used to refer to any substantial meal that is served just before a parent goes to bed at night (either while they are awake or while they are sleeping).
